Output 84be751aed31dbbee64c4e08a1a0cfa76c2d36214e29beb70135804dbcf2d414:0

value
20193210
script pubkey
OP_0 OP_PUSHBYTES_20 52f352b61e696d48bd4396d11eb6fa7af9ddc75d
address
bc1q2te49ds7d9k5302rjmg3adh60tuam36aw22dzl
transaction
84be751aed31dbbee64c4e08a1a0cfa76c2d36214e29beb70135804dbcf2d414
confirmations
66474
spent
true